TwitterGoogle PlusFacebook
100% natural in origin

The best skin care treatment products in Canada

Natural Indulgence is at the cutting edge of a woman’s natural and organic skin care needs.

Natural Indulgence harnesses the benefits of nature with essential oil elixirs that are primarily 100% natural in origin. Natural Indulgence formulas contain high quality natural ingredients. Each ingredient is thoroughly researched and blended into each product to work with specific skin conditions for optimal efficacy. Each product is designed to nurture the skin and foster natural beauty and well-being.